Q: Turnstile counter at Hallow Field stopped incrementing — what now? A: Restart the GateTally agent on the north concourse node. Counts backfill automatically from the spinner logs. If the admin console rejects your session during the restart, use the recovery passphrase below.

vault phrase of taweg-kafof = oliax-zorael

## Tuning

We replaced the homegrown Lintbarrow queue with the new Ferrowisp worker pool in release 0.9. The old polling loop is gone; workers now lease jobs with visibility timeouts and heartbeat renewals. Most defaults are fine for local development, but staging and production need explicit values or you will see lease churn under load. Start with the defaults, measure, then adjust one knob at a time. The current production constants are listed below.

tuning constants:
QUOTAS = {
    "druwyn": 5,
    "holix": 5,
    "zorath": 5,
    "holwyn": 10,
}

### Runbook: Replica Lag Alarm — Dovetail Ledger

When the read-replica lag alarm fires, first verify the primary in the Northgate region is accepting writes normally; a stalled primary produces misleading lag figures. Next, check whether a bulk backfill job is running, since those are the usual culprit. The alarm thresholds and polling cadence are controlled by the values below.

settings of fafog-haduf:
ZORIX_PIN=4648
ZORIX_METRICS_HOST=metrics.zorix.paliqsys.corp
ZORIX_LOG_LEVEL=info
ZORIX_TENANT=druix